    Touring Rattle

    My Touring has a rattle from the dog fence (luggage cover, big grey thing that sits on top of the rear seat).

    I have added washers to the springs to try and tighten up the fit, but they're not working.

    The rattle occurs because the whole assemble can rotate slightly forward and backward. I don't see any significant wear on any of the two mounting ends.

    Anybody know how to fix this?

    #2
    Yes, remove the cover or cover the mating surfaces with something very thin and isolating. Do remember that the internals or end caps of the cover can also rattle.

    Alternately, the rattle is actually from the speaker wells aft of the seats or the storage areas.

          I wrapped a 1" wide piece of duct tape (2 wraps) around each center post of the removable cover. That seems to have fixed it for now. We'll see how long it lasts.
